Social media as an instrument of activism for feminist university students in Mexico: the cases of MOFFyL and Uni Unida
In this chapter, we analyze the use of social media in the development of two Mexican feminist university collectives—Universidad Nacional Autónoma de México’s MOFFyL and Universidad Autónoma de Ciudad Juárez’s Uni Unida—focusing on the role of such media as means of online and offline activism.
